A Bruno Mars tribute act from Swansea gets a date on Take Me Out

A Bruno Mars tribute act from Swansea has got himself a date on Take Me Out.

Martin Kurina, who works in Debenhams in the Quadrant shopping centre, appeared on the ITV dating show on Saturday night.

After coming down the lift dancing to Despacito, he managed to bag himself a date to the infamous isle of Fernando's.

During the second round of the show, the shop worker described himself as a "fun, outgoing and positive guy" and initially rated himself a ten out of ten before dropping to a more modest nine.

He said that when it comes to looking for a partner he has always gone for looks "but if the personality isn't there then she's like gone-off cheese", which prompted a number of girls to turn their lights off.

The Swansea boy managed to bag himself a date to the isle of Fernando's (ITV)

The self-confessed Bruno Mars fan was seen dancing through Swansea's city centre and even revealed that he can speak six different languages.

Martin returned for the final round dressed as his "inspiration" Bruno Mars as he belted out 'Uptown Funk' in a bid to impress the women. 

There were a number of women with their lights still on for the Swansea boy and he whittled it down to just two before eventually picking Shan.

But not before he made them both show him their best dance moves.
